Tuition

Tuition is paid over a 10-month period with the first tuition payment being due on July 1st. Future tuition payments are due on the 1st of every month, with the final installment due on April 1st.

Payment can be made by check, money order, or by a credit/debit card. Regardless of how you make your payment, please remember to include your family number with each payment. Please note that any payment made after the 10th of the month will incur a $25.00 late fee. Families in arrears of 2 months or more, will have to conference with the Principal and possibly the Tuition Review Board to make arrangement to catch up with payments.

Please note, Report Cards cannot be issued to families with an outstanding balance and Parent Conferences will not include specifics found in the Report Cards. Letters from the office may not be requested if you have an outstanding balance.

For returning students to begin class in September, they cannot have a balance from the previous school year. New students that are transferring from Catholic schools may not have a balance remaining at their previous school.

Financial Aid

Partial tuition assistance is available through Futures in Education!

Financial aid is available for eligible students in grades K to 8 who attend a Catholic Academy or Parish School within the Diocese of Brooklyn. Families must meet financial eligibility requirements to be considered.

FACTS is a third-party vendor selected by Futures in Education to conduct fair and confidential financial need assessments. To learn more about Futures in Education, please visit futuresineducation.org.
